Output a381ae072194b6460daa481bd2f425016ee11c535f476baa39c87398e5166c1c:31

value
10957806
script pubkey
OP_0 OP_PUSHBYTES_20 f04d5ad26d45617e7f9d1c2986468fa8ad4d67f9
address
bc1q7px445ndg4shuluars5cv3504zk56eleaqvypy
transaction
a381ae072194b6460daa481bd2f425016ee11c535f476baa39c87398e5166c1c
confirmations
281089
spent
true